James Madison University, located in the picturesque Shenandoah Valley of Harrisonburg, Virginia, is renowned for its vibrant campus life and strong academic programs. Embracing a community-centered approach, JMU fosters an environment where students thrive both intellectually and socially.

FAQs

How much does James Madison University cost?

For the most recent year, it cost $34,746 to attend James Madison.

How many people attend James Madison University?

22,879 people attend James Madison. 21,112 are undergraduate students and 1,767 are graduate students.

Where is James Madison University located?

James Madison University is located in Harrisonburg, Virginia. It is in a Town environment.
